Shape the future of microbiological research as a Professor in Bacteriophage Biology & Evolution at UBC. The role focuses on bacteria-phage dynamics and interdisciplinary collaborations.

At the University of British Columbia, we are seeking a distinguished applicant for a faculty position in Bacteriophage Biology & Evolution. This position requires a PhD and postdoctoral experience, coupled with a proven track record in impactful research. You will lead an innovative program, engage in student supervision, and teach microbiology courses, while being a crucial member of the PrePARE research cluster that addresses infectious diseases.

Key Responsibilities:



• Conduct pioneering research in bacteria-phage interactions • Mentor and supervise graduate and postdoctoral researchers • Develop and teach courses on relevant microbiological topics • Establish collaborations with departments across UBC • Contribute to the academic and scientific community activities

Requirements: • PhD with postdoctoral experience in microbiology or related fields • Proven research accomplishments with strong publication history • Ability to secure externally funded research • Commitment to fostering an inclusive research workplace • Willingness to participate in interdisciplinary projects
